|
|
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Привет. Можно по нубить ? Молчание знак согласия. Я начинаю. Мне нужно сделать CHM файл. Соответственно нужно создать кучу HTMLек. Буду делать это на простеньком HTML, который сейчас и изучу заодно, как раз выдалось свободные минут 30-40. Нашел нужные бесплатные редакторы. Все ок. В процессе возникают вопросы. 1. Я правильно понимаю, что для написания простой справки CHM будет достаточно простого HTML без JavaScript и прочего ? 2. Есть идея, на каждой страничке в футере писать версию программы, для которой актуальна справка. Соответственно нужно где-то эту переменную хранить в файле, и все странички при отображении (и компиляции в CHM) должны ее подгружать. Не хочеться, после изменения версии программы лазить по всем страничкам и через поиск менять одну строку на другую. Как это можно сделать ? 3. Зачем нужен тэг <kbd> ? В чем его суть, и необходимость. 4. В одном из исходников HTML страниц, которые сейчас изучаю, встретил странный код "<h2>$this-(&)gt;</h2>". Но в отображении страницы он превращаеться в "$this->" (скобочки пришлось добавить, т.к. в ЭТОМ редакторе тоже заменяеться на символ '>') почему (&)gt; превратилось в '>' ? Я не нашел такого тэга. Это не тэг, а что-то другое ? Зачем понадобилось писать такой код, если можно просто написать "$this->" ? Можете прямо под нумерами и отвечать :) Спасибо !! Если еще вопросы появяться, добавлю пост потом в эту тему. PS. Когда нибудь через год, когда стану великим веб разработчиком, консультирующим Дино Эспозито, буду вспоминать эту темку со смехом :) Но ВЫ можете читать эту темку со смехом уже сейчас.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 16:39:28 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Dualcore, 1. Да 2. В HTML нет возможности включать кусок из внешнего файла, но нужного эффекта можно достичь с помощью <iframe>-ов или JavaScript. 3. Для отметки того что требуется вводить с клавиатуры. http://www.w3schools.com/tags/tag_phrase_elements.asp 4. Это последовательность называется html entity и нужна чтобы браузер вывел знак меньше как-есть, не пытаясь интерпретировать его как начало тега.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 16:50:49 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Dualcore CHM не работает под Win7, если что.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:00:05 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
AntonariyCHM не работает под Win7, если что. Работает. Единственное что может понадобиться, это "разблокировать" файл скачанный из инета.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:04:58 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
AntonariyDualcore CHM не работает под Win7, если что. Я не проверял, но это очень странно. CHM выбрал почитав эту статью http://www.gunsmoker.ru/2011/02/delphi.html#formats Вроде как CHM являеться рекомендуемым форматом. А в каком тогда формате нужно писать справки, чтобы читались И на Вынь7 (и на XP само собой) 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:05:29 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Насчет тэша <kbd> я так и не понял ! Я в общем то и прочитал в справке, что мол тэг отображает клавиатурный ввод. Но я не нашел что это означает :)) Можете объяснить ? Мне не критично, но просто интеерсно. Также как и тэг <samp>. Когда их надо использовать например 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:10:19 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
bazileAntonariyCHM не работает под Win7, если что. Работает. Единственное что может понадобиться, это "разблокировать" файл скачанный из инета.Файлы древние, наверное сто лет как разблокированные. Но проверю еще раз. При попытке открыть скомпилированный HTML Help (.Файл CHM) на Windows Vista или Windows 7, файл может открыть, но отображается одно из следующих сообщений вместо ожидаемого содержимого: Переход на веб-страницу была отменена. Действие отменено.Ничего похожего. Файлы открываеются без всяких сообщений, оглавление присутствует, а вместо текстов — пустые страницы.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:12:26 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Antonariyвместо текстов — пустые страницы. Насколько я помню, у CHM есть такой глюк, если файл располагаеться в каталоге с русскими символами.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:15:53 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
DualcoreМне не критично, но просто интеерсно. Также как и тэг <samp>. Когда их надо использовать например ? Код: html 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:18:01 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
bazile Спасибо. Хотя вы меня таки не поняли :) Я спрашивал не как его применять, и как его писать, а КОГДА применять. Т.е. в чем суть этого оператора, ЧТО он делает. Ладно. Не важно :) Мне на самом деле не нужен этот тэг полагаю.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:29:44 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
DualcoreЯ спрашивал не как его применять, и как его писать, а КОГДА применять. Т.е. в чем суть этого оператора, ЧТО он делает. Пример именно это и иллюстрирует. Разберу по частям раз непонятно. Представим что пишем справку по командной строке Windows и описываем команду dir. Текст внутри тега <kbd> содержит текст который пользователю нужно ввести с клавиатуры в командном интерпретаторе: Код: html 1. Затем внутри тега <samp> мы показываем каким может быть вывод на экран после выполнения данной команды. Код: html 1. 2. 3. 4. 5. 6. Данный пример иллюстрирует семантическую природу языка HTML то есть необходимость выбора тегов в зависимости от природы информации в тексте. Для обычного текста у нас есть заголовки (<h1> ... <h6>), параграфы (<p>), таблицы и набор различных строчных элементов. В HTML 5 был добавлен ряд новых элементов для описания структуры документа. Изучи их полный список чтобы лучше понимать возможности языка. Визуальное представление документа должно управляться с помощью языка CSS. P.S. Обрати внимание, что конструкция <kbd> называется тегом, а без угловых скобок элементом. Слово оператор здесь неуместно.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 17:53:42 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
bazile, Спасибо большое за "необходимость выбора тегов в зависимости от природы информации в тексте". Теперь понял более менее. Может найду применение в справке. С CSS почти разобрался. Использую найденный какой-то стиль. Получается весьма симпотишно, мне многого и не надо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 18:14:52 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
автор "у меня появились 30 минут, учите меня!" - Что за наглость? Книгу то открой! И странные вы исходники смотрите. Судя по "<h2>$this-(&)gt;</h2>" там присутствует "PHP" или что-то подобное..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 20:05:56 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
DualcoreAntonariyвместо текстов — пустые страницы. Насколько я помню, у CHM есть такой глюк, если файл располагаеться в каталоге с русскими символами.Перепроверил, работает. О_о 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 21:26:31 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
В том числе с русскими путями.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 21:29:16 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Antonariy, что бы помнить - нужно знать! :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.10.2012, 21:35:56 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Seegileавтор "у меня появились 30 минут, учите меня!" - Что за наглость? эээ. вы домыслили текст, которого нет и в помине. Собственно в свободные 30-40 минут я и планировал изучать HTML. Сам. Я не просил учить меня, лишь ответить на несколько нубских вопросов. Если вы ЭТО считаете учебой... Ну а вообще мне стоило там выставить таблицу "сарказм" что ли, ибо полноценного изучения HTML не планируеться, мне бы только CHM создать и все.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:36:30 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
ЗЫ. пример текста "<h2>$this-(&)gt;</h2>" я взял из декомпильнутого взятого с потолка первого попавшегося CHM файла, описывающего какой-то фреймворк для вебдизайна на PHP вроде :) Т.е. там просто в CHM примеры кода приведены, и меня просто заинтересовало, почему символ '>' не прописан явно, а заменен каким-то кодом, потому и спросил :) Спасибо за помощь всем, эни вэй !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:42:16 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
AntonariyВ том числе с русскими путями. Я точно помню у себя такой глюк, давно это было. Лет так 3-5 назад, когда я какую-то справку открывал на Win XP. Тогда и узнал, что если открывать файлик из каталога, с русскими путями, то он пустой открываеться, но стоит только скопировать в папку с английкими, то все работает. Счас проверил, на моей Win XP даже из под русских каталогов открываеться. Наверное просто уже давно исправленно это.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:48:09 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Dualcoreпочему символ '>' не прописан явно, а заменен каким-то кодом Может быть потому что "<>" - это служебный символ не для вывода?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:49:12 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
Dualcore, кстати, попробуй написать текст "</textarea>" в textarea и у тебя ничего не получится.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:52:28 |
|
||
|
Вопросы от HTML нуба. Hello World !
|
|||
|---|---|---|---|
|
#18+
SeegileDualcoreпочему символ '>' не прописан явно, а заменен каким-то кодом Может быть потому что "<>" - это служебный символ не для вывода? Для человека столкнувшимся с HTML в первые (не считая каких-то коротких курсов в институте лет 10 назад) думаю позволительно не догадаться об этом, хотя идеи конечно были... Просто спросил.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.10.2012, 11:52:33 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38000045&tid=1449230]: |
0ms |
get settings: |
7ms |
get forum list: |
14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
18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
57ms |
get tp. blocked users: |
2ms |
| others: | 206ms |
| total: | 321ms |

| 0 / 0 |
